Core ROI Benchmarks and Returns

Email marketing consistently outperforms other digital channels in terms of return on investment. These statistics show the baseline ROI figures businesses can expect across different scenarios, from average returns to top-performing programs.

1

$36 average return for every $1 spent on email marketing

Email consistently delivers the highest ROI of any digital marketing channel. This baseline figure represents the average return businesses can expect, making email a reliable investment compared to social media, paid search, or other channels.

Litmus State of Email Report 2024-2025
2

$10 to $36 ROI range reported by 35% of companies

One-third of organizations achieve returns between $10 and $36 for every dollar invested, representing the established baseline for email marketing performance and serving as a realistic benchmark for most businesses.

Litmus State of Email Survey 2025
3

Email ROI ranges from 10:1 to 36:1 for most organizations

Top-performing email programs exceed 50:1 ROI, while average programs typically deliver 10:1 to 36:1 returns. Successful programs use data-driven timing and targeting to maximize returns relative to spend.

HubSpot Email Marketing ROI Guide 2025
4

18% of companies achieve email ROI greater than $70 for every $1 spent

High-performing businesses demonstrate that exceptional ROI is achievable with optimization. These top performers typically use advanced segmentation, personalization, and automation to reach this level.

Campaign Monitor and eMarketer 2025
5

$42 to $45 ROI for retail, eCommerce, and consumer goods businesses

These industries achieve the highest email ROI of any sector, reaching $45 per dollar spent. This higher performance is driven by direct purchase attribution and high-intent customer bases.

DMA and Industry Benchmarks 2025-2026
6

320% more revenue from automated emails compared to manual sends

Automation dramatically amplifies ROI by triggering timely, relevant messages based on customer behavior. This uplift underscores why businesses using email automation achieve superior returns.

Campaign Monitor 2024
7

43% higher ROI for brands using email analytics tools

Organizations leveraging external analytics and testing tools achieve substantially better returns, demonstrating that measurement and optimization directly impact profitability.

Litmus State of Email Survey 2025
8

Email flows generate 41% of total revenue from just 5.3% of email sends

Automated workflows deliver disproportionate revenue impact, with average revenue per recipient 18x higher than standard campaigns, proving automation is the primary revenue driver for top performers.

Klaviyo Email Marketing Benchmarks 2026

Automation, Personalization, and Campaign Performance

Automation and personalization are the primary drivers of higher email ROI. This section covers how triggered emails, automated flows, and personalized content directly impact revenue and conversion rates.

9

Automated emails drive 37% of all email-generated sales despite representing just 2% of total email volume

While automated workflows account for a tiny fraction of overall email sends, they generate more than one-third of total email revenue. This disparity reveals the outsized impact of triggered emails and behavioral automation compared to traditional batch-and-blast campaigns.

Omnisend 2026 Email Marketing Statistics Report
10

Automated emails generate 320% more revenue than non-automated emails

Email automation consistently outperforms standard campaign sends by a significant margin. This metric demonstrates why shifting budget toward triggered workflows, welcome sequences, and abandoned cart flows yields measurably higher returns.

Campaign Monitor 2024-2025 Email Benchmark Report
11

Personalized subject lines increase open rates by 20-26%

Personalization at the subject line level directly impacts inbox performance. When recipients see their name or relevant personalization cues, open rates improve significantly, making subject line customization one of the highest-leverage personalization tactics.

Adobe for Business, 2025
12

Segmented and personalized emails generate 58% of all email revenue

Segmentation and personalization drive disproportionate revenue share. Despite representing a subset of total email volume, targeted campaigns account for more than half of total email-generated sales, proving that relevance drives conversion.

Instapage Personalization Statistics 2025
13

Back-in-stock emails achieved 6.46% conversion rate, the highest among automated email types

Back-in-stock alerts trigger immediate purchase intent since recipients have already demonstrated product interest. This automation type consistently outperforms other triggered workflows, converting at rates 10-15x higher than standard campaigns.

Omnisend 2025 Ecommerce Marketing Statistics Report
14

Brands using personalization increase email ROI by nearly 260% compared to non-personalized campaigns

Personalization amplifies email ROI across the board. The 260% uplift demonstrates that investing in dynamic content, behavioral triggers, and audience segmentation directly compounds campaign profitability and customer lifetime value.

Litmus Email Personalization Report, 2025
15

Automated emails generated $2.87 per email while campaign emails averaged $0.18 per email

Revenue-per-send reveals the financial gap between automation and standard campaigns. Automated workflows generate 16x more revenue per email delivered, making automation not just a time-saver but a direct revenue multiplier.

Omnisend 2025-2026 Email Marketing Data Report
16

Automated behavioral segmentation increased email revenue by 40% in 5 months for one DTC brand

Behavioral segmentation combined with automation delivered measurable revenue growth. A skincare brand moved from 2 email segments to 11 behavioral segments and increased annual email revenue by $153,600, proving segment-driven automation is ROI-positive.

US Tech Automations Case Study, 2025
17

Segmented email campaigns generate 30% more opens and 50% more click-throughs than non-segmented campaigns

Segmentation fundamentally improves engagement metrics. Relevance drives opens and clicks more effectively than volume, making list segmentation a prerequisite for campaign performance and ROI growth.

Mailchimp Email Marketing Benchmarks, 2025

Email Volume, User Base, and Adoption Trends

Email usage continues to grow globally, with billions of users checking email daily. Understanding the scale of email adoption helps contextualize why it remains such a valuable marketing channel.

18

4.6 billion people use email globally in 2025, with adoption reaching 56% of the world population

Email has achieved near-universal penetration as the most widely adopted digital communication channel. This massive user base represents more than double the population of any social media platform, making email the dominant channel for reaching audiences at scale.

Statista (2025), cited by EmailToolTester and multiple industry sources
19

376.4 billion emails are sent and received daily in 2025, projected to reach 424 billion by 2026

Daily email volume continues climbing year-over-year despite competition from chat apps and social media. This represents roughly 50 emails for every person on Earth each day, underscoring email's role as critical business and personal infrastructure.

Statista (2025), The Radicati Group
20

4.73 billion email users are projected for 2026, up from 4.59 billion in 2025

Email adoption continues growing at roughly 3% annually, with emerging markets like India and Nigeria driving expansion. By 2027, the user base is expected to exceed 4.8 billion, representing sustained long-term growth in global email infrastructure.

Statista (2025), cited by EmailToolTester and WebToffee
21

93% of email users check their inbox daily, with 42% checking it 3-5 times per day

Email engagement remains exceptionally high despite inbox saturation. Users prioritize email as an essential daily tool ahead of social media or news, with professionals checking email roughly every 37 minutes on average.

Designmodo (2025), citing industry benchmarks
22

81% of B2B marketers actively use email as part of their marketing strategy

Email has achieved near-universal adoption among marketing professionals. B2B organizations consistently rank email as their most effective channel, with 54% of US businesses identifying it as their top-performing marketing vehicle compared to all other options.

SalesHandy (2026), based on industry survey data
23

Nearly 4.5 billion email accounts exist globally, with the average user maintaining 1.86 accounts

The proliferation of email accounts (both personal and professional) exceeds the number of email users, reflecting the multi-account behavior of most professionals. This creates substantial opportunity for marketers to reach audiences across different contexts and preferences.

EmailToolTester (2025), citing Radicati Group data
24

88% of email users check their inbox multiple times daily, with 61% accessing email primarily on mobile

Email consumption is increasingly mobile-first, with the majority of first interactions happening on smartphones. High daily check frequency creates repeated touch points for marketers to deliver relevant, timely messages throughout the day.

ZeroBounce (2023-2024), cited by multiple industry sources including EntrepreneursHQ
25

Global email marketing revenue is projected to grow from $14.8 billion in 2025 to $36.3 billion by 2033

Email marketing spending is accelerating at an 11.7% compound annual growth rate. This investment surge reflects growing recognition that email delivers measurable ROI and remains essential infrastructure for customer acquisition, retention, and revenue generation.

Growth Market Reports (2025), cited by Hostinger

Engagement Metrics and Open/Click-Through Rates

Open rates, click-through rates, and engagement metrics vary by industry and campaign type. These benchmarks help marketers set realistic performance targets and identify optimization opportunities.

26

43.46% average email open rate in 2025, up from 42.35% in 2024

Open rates have continued to climb despite privacy concerns, though Apple Mail Privacy Protection artificially inflates these numbers. This data comes from analysis of 3.6 million campaigns, making it one of the largest datasets available.

MailerLite Email Marketing Benchmarks 2025
27

6.81% average click-to-open rate (CTOR) in 2025, up from 5.63% in 2024

Click-to-open rate measures what percentage of people who opened your email actually clicked on something. This metric has become more reliable than open rates for measuring true engagement since it requires deliberate action.

MailerLite Email Marketing Benchmarks 2025
28

2.09% average email click rate across all industries in 2025

Click rates vary by industry from 0.83% to 4.90%, with legal leading at 4.90%, manufacturing at 4.22%, and media at 4.10%. Click rate is becoming the most reliable metric as it's not affected by Apple Mail Privacy Protection.

MailerLite Email Marketing Benchmarks 2025
29

6.21% average click rate across all campaigns sent in 2025

This broader metric includes transactional, marketing, and other campaign types across customers of all sizes and industries. It demonstrates that comprehensive email programs drive meaningful engagement.

ActiveCampaign Email Marketing Benchmarks 2026
30

30.7% average email open rate in ecommerce in 2025, with 38% for automated emails

Ecommerce open rates rose for the fifth consecutive year from 26.6% in 2024 to 30.7% in 2025. Automated emails significantly outperform campaigns, with automated emails generating $2.87 per email versus $0.18 for campaigns.

Omnisend 2026 Ecommerce Marketing Statistics Report
31

42.35% average email open rate across all industries based on 3.3 million campaigns

This represents the global median open rate in 2025 from analysis of over 155,000 accounts. Industry variation is dramatic, ranging from 59.70% in religion to 31.08% in ecommerce.

Genesysgrowth Email Open Rates Statistics 2026
32

21.33% Q1 2025 average email open rate with wide industry variation

This metric reflects the impact of Apple Mail Privacy Protection on reported open rates. Some sources report lower averages (21.5%) when accounting for the inflation from automatic image preloading.

Mailchimp Industry Benchmarks 2026
33

47.11% open rate and 10% click-to-open rate for government emails, highest CTOR

Government communications demonstrate exceptional engagement, with the highest click-to-open rates in the dataset. This reflects the trusted sender status and critical importance of government communications to recipients.

Genesysgrowth Email Statistics 2026
34

3.5x higher click-through rate for email flows versus campaigns in 2026

Automated flows deliver 5.58% CTR compared to 1.69% for campaigns, proving that relevance and timing outweigh frequency. Flows generate nearly 41% of total email revenue from just 5.3% of sends.

Klaviyo 2026 Email Marketing Benchmarks

Industry-Specific ROI and Conversion Data

Different industries see different returns from email marketing based on customer behavior, product type, and buying cycles. Retail and ecommerce lead with the highest per-dollar returns, while B2B follows with different attribution models.

35

$45 in ROI for retail, ecommerce, and consumer goods for every $1 spent on email

Retail and ecommerce lead all industries with the highest email marketing returns. These sectors benefit from direct product-to-purchase pathways and high customer engagement from promotional content and abandoned cart recovery flows.

Constant Contact 2026
36

72% ROI in US ecommerce versus $36 globally, showing 2x higher returns in mature markets

US ecommerce brands significantly outperform the global average, driven by higher average order values, more sophisticated automation, and more mature email programs with advanced segmentation and personalization tactics.

Omnisend 2026 Ecommerce Report
37

Games (15.1%), food & drink (14.9%), and health (14.8%) industries see the highest email conversion rates in 2025

These industries outperform retail and general ecommerce on conversion rates, reflecting strong product affinity, customer urgency in purchasing decisions, and effective use of email automation for time-sensitive or lifestyle-focused offers.

Omnisend 2026 Ecommerce Marketing Statistics
38

B2B emails deliver 23% higher click-to-open ratios than B2C emails, signaling stronger engagement quality

B2B audiences are more self-selected and motivated, resulting in higher engagement even with lower overall open rates. This difference reflects purchase intent and the decision-maker status of B2B recipients compared to consumer audiences.

DemandSage 2026 Email Marketing Statistics
39

IT and telecommunications firms report 73% rating email ROI as excellent or very good, the highest of all industries

Technology-driven sectors show the strongest satisfaction with email ROI because digital-native buyers expect email communication, use it to research solutions, and purchase through self-directed evaluation processes that email supports directly.

Sopro State of Prospecting 2025
40

Automated emails drive 30% of ecommerce revenue from just 2% of sends, earning 16x more per send than scheduled campaigns

Automation significantly outperforms broadcast campaigns due to relevance, timing, and behavioral triggers. Welcome emails, abandoned cart sequences, and post-purchase flows deliver the highest per-email revenue and drive new customer acquisition at scale.

Omnisend 2026 Ecommerce Report
41

Ecommerce brands see 30 to 40% of total store revenue from email when using optimized automation flows

High-performing ecommerce programs attribute roughly one-third of annual revenue directly to email, with the majority coming from well-segmented automation rather than single-send campaigns. This benchmark reflects the power of lifecycle email when properly executed.

Ringly.io Ecommerce Email Marketing Statistics 2026
42

B2B marketers report 42% citing email as their most effective marketing channel, consistent year-over-year

Email maintains dominance in B2B for lead generation and nurturing because it aligns with how decision-makers research and evaluate solutions. Unlike paid channels, email provides direct access to established prospect lists and supports long sales cycles.

Omnisend 2026 B2B Email Statistics

Comparison to Other Marketing Channels

Email consistently outperforms social media, paid search, and content marketing in direct ROI comparison. These statistics highlight why savvy marketers prioritize email as their top-performing channel.

43

Email marketing delivers 3,500% ROI, compared to SEO's 317-1,389% and social media's 250%

Email consistently outperforms major marketing channels by significant margins. This benchmark makes email the clear winner for ROI-focused marketers allocating budget across multiple channels, particularly when competing against paid search or organic social strategies.

EmailToolTester (2025)
44

42% of marketers rank email as their most effective channel, versus 16% for social media and paid search combined

Email dominance in marketer perception is striking. Social media and paid search tie at 16% each, meaning marketers find email nearly 3 times more effective than any single alternative, reflecting confidence in email's conversion power.

DesignModo (2026)
45

Email generates $36 for every dollar spent, while social media yields just $2.80 per dollar

The dollar-for-dollar comparison reveals email's efficiency advantage. For every $1 invested, email returns 12.8 times more than social media marketing, making it the obvious choice for brands measuring direct revenue impact from marketing spend.

The Harman Media & Marketing Group (2025)
46

50% of consumers purchased directly from email in 2024, outpacing purchases from social media posts or ads

Consumer behavior proves email's sales impact. Half of all surveyed consumers reported making direct purchases triggered by email, demonstrating that engaged subscribers convert at rates social media platforms struggle to match even with algorithm-driven targeting.

DesignModo (2026)
47

Email generates 4.24% conversion rate from traffic, compared to 2.49% from search and 0.59% from social media

Conversion rate data shows email's visitor-to-customer efficiency. Email traffic converts 7 times better than social media and nearly twice as well as search traffic, indicating email subscribers are uniquely qualified and motivated to buy.

Shopify (2025)
